R531 RVJ is a 1998 Rover Maestro in White with a 1,275c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.

Across all 1998 Rover Maestro models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.0% with a typical mileage of 92,352 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Rover Maestro f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 3,111 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R531 RVJ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Rover Maestro typ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 28 years old, this Rover Maestro is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
